CVE-2016-0002 Information

Description

The Microsoft (1) VBScript 5.7 and 5.8 and (2) JScript 5.7 and 5.8 engines as used in Internet Explorer 8 through 11 and other products all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ted web site aka \Scripting Engine Memory Corruption Vulnerability.\
